PRODUCT OVERVIEW

The Anker SOLIX 522 is a compact 299Wh portable power station designed to charge up to 6 devices at once—perfect for off-grid adventures like camping, tailgating, RV trips, or as a home backup during power outages. It powers 99% of consumer electronics, including phones, laptops, drones, TVs, fans, and more. Weighing just 8.6 lbs, it’s easy to carry wherever you go.

KEY FEATURES

6 Versatile Outlets – Includes 2 AC outlets, 2 USB-C ports, 1 USB-A port, and 1 DC car port—ideal for charging everything from phones to lights and laptops.

Reliable Power On-the-Go – Keeps essentials like CPAP machines, mini fridges, and Wi-Fi routers running, so you’re always prepared—whether at a campsite or during an outage.

Multiple Charging Methods – Recharge via wall outlet, car charger, USB-C 60W PD, or compatible solar panels like the Anker 625 (sold separately).

Built to Last – Powered by long-lasting InfiniPower tech and EV-grade LiFePO4 batteries, plus a smart temperature control system and drop-resistant design. Delivers 3,000 cycles and up to 10 years of use.

Warranty & Safety – Enjoy peace of mind with a 5-year warranty. The SOLIX 522 runs quietly and cleanly—no gas, fumes, or noise—making it perfect for indoor or outdoor use.

Power Saving Mode – Automatically shuts off ports when devices are fully charged to conserve energy and extend battery life.

600W SurgePad Mode – Boost power output to handle higher-wattage appliances like desktop computers or blenders.
